What Cookies Really Do
Cookies are small text files placed on your device when you visit a website. They help the site recognize your browser, remember certain settings, support security features, and understand how visitors use the site.
Cookies do not usually contain directly identifying information by themselves, but they can be linked to other information associated with your account or device. Similar technologies, such as pixels, tags, scripts, and local storage, may also be used for similar purposes. For simplicity, this policy refers to all of these tools as “cookies.”

The Key Types of Cookies We May Use
Different cookies serve different purposes. Some are required for the website to function, while others are optional and used to improve performance or tailor content.
Essential Cookies
Essential cookies are necessary for the website to operate properly. These cookies enable core functions such as page navigation, secure logins, fraud prevention, session management, and access to protected areas of the site.
Without these cookies, certain services may not work correctly. For example, you may not be able to sign in, stay logged into your account, submit forms, or use secure areas of the website.
Functional Cookies
Functional cookies allow the site to remember choices you make and provide enhanced features. This may include remembering your language, region, device preferences, or support settings.
These cookies can make your experience more convenient by saving settings between visits. If disabled, some personalized features may no longer work as intended.
Performance and Analytics Cookies
Performance cookies help us understand how visitors interact with the website. They can show which pages receive the most visits, how users move through the site, and whether any technical problems are affecting the user experience.
Analytics tools supported by cookies may collect information such as browser type, device type, approximate location, time spent on pages, referral sources, and interaction patterns. This information is generally used in aggregated or de-identified form to improve the website’s design, speed, content, and performance.
Marketing Cookies
Marketing cookies may be used to measure the effectiveness of advertising, limit how often an ad is shown, or help display content that is more relevant to your interests.
These cookies can be set by us or by third-party advertising and measurement partners. If you disable marketing cookies, you may still see ads, but they may be less relevant to you.

How Long Cookies Stay on Your Device
Some cookies are session cookies. These are temporary and expire when you close your browser.
Others are persistent cookies. These remain on your device for a set period or until you delete them manually. Persistent cookies help remember settings and recognize returning visitors over time.
The lifespan of a cookie depends on its purpose. We aim to use retention periods that are reasonable and proportionate to the function the cookie performs.

How to Manage, Disable, or Delete Cookies
Most web browsers allow you to control cookies through their settings. You can usually choose to block certain cookies, delete stored cookies, or receive alerts before cookies are placed.
Browser controls vary, but they are generally found in the Privacy, Security, or Settings menu of your browser. You may also be able to manage cookies separately on different devices, such as your laptop, tablet, or smartphone.
If you disable or remove cookies, some parts of the website may not function correctly. You may need to re-enter preferences, log in again, or experience issues with page performance, support tools, or account-related features.
Browser-Level Controls You Can Use
Most users manage cookie settings through their browser. Common browser options may include blocking third-party cookies, clearing browsing data, limiting tracking technologies, or enabling private browsing modes.
Keep in mind that private or incognito modes may reduce cookie storage, but they do not always block all tracking technologies. If you use multiple browsers, you will need to update settings in each one separately.
Do Not Track and Similar Signals
Some browsers offer a “Do Not Track” setting. Because there is no single, universally accepted standard for how websites should respond to these signals, our website may not respond to them in every case.
However, you can still use the cookie choices described in this policy and your browser settings to manage your privacy preferences.
